Answer to Question 1

Preliminary injunctions are used when a plaintiff alleges that the actions of the defendant are harming the plaintiff and they require that a defendant cease and desist, which means they are no longer able to continue doing what the plaintiff claims is harming him or her.

Answer to Question 2

Statute of limitations are laws that limit the amount of time that a plaintiff has to file a lawsuit in order to prevent open-ended liability, which is being responsible for an action for an indefinite period of time.

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) was originally known as the Communicable Disease Center, which was formed to fight malaria. It was originally head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, since the Southern states faced the worst threat from malaria.

Many people have small pouches in their colons that bulge outward through weak spots. Each pouch is called a diverticulum. About 10% of Americans older than age 40 years have diverticulosis, which, when the pouches become infected or inflamed, is called diverticulitis. The main cause of diverticular disease is a low-fiber diet.

I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.
